FastKeys is an all-in-one Windows automation platform. Its functionality includes a fully configurable text expander, start menu, mouse gestures, etc. The tool allows the users to generate user-defined commands to operate files or to automate any function. Some features are as follows:

  • running script via cron does not provide full output
    If you read the docs for Speedtest-CLI you will see that the program timeouts after 10 seconds. Try using this for default timeout of 1 minute and also redirect errors to the same file. Speedtest-cli --timeout 60 >> /bin/speedtestoutput.txt 2>&1. Source: over 1 year ago
